Step 1: Understanding the circulatory system.
The blood flow in the human circulatory system follows a specific route starting and ending in the heart. The left ventricle pumps oxygenated blood to the body via the aorta. After reaching the organs and tissues, the blood returns through the systemic veins to the vena cavae, then enters the right atrium and ventricle. The right ventricle pumps the deoxygenated blood to the lungs through the pulmonary artery. Oxygenated blood returns to the left atrium and ventricle via the pulmonary vein.
